Publication number: 20190385164Abstract: Described herein are techniques for facilitating push provisioning of a user payment source into a user's digital wallet without the user having a physical card. The techniques allow an issuer to provide a button in an issuer's mobile application for the user to simply push the button to request that the payment source be imported into the user's digital pay wallet. In this way, the payment source information is “pushed” into the pay wallet. Using push provisioning, the user need not enter any physical card information. The described techniques generate a chain of trust that can be used to ensure that a user, through an issuer and using an encryption gateway, authorizes a token service provider to provision the payment source into the user's digital wallet.Type: ApplicationFiled: June 17, 2019Publication date: December 19, 2019Applicant: First Data CorporationInventors: Vijay Royyuru, Benjamin Rewis, SR., Lanny Byers, Renee Goodheart, Cindy White, Kelly Urban, Skyler Fox

Publication number: 20140330675Abstract: Methods and system for determining reputation information are provided. The method includes analyzing transactional and non-transactional information for an alias associated with an entity and determining reputation information for that alias. The reputation information is transferrable across multiple domains. A user can request the reputation information about an entity prior to doing business with that entity. The reputation information is generated for merchants as well as users. The system can generate transaction risk score for every transaction to be conducted between two or more aliases. The system includes an alias identity and reputation validation server computer that receives inputs from various external systems and generated reputation information based on the inputs. Additionally, every individual user/merchant can manage his profile within the reputation database and enter some information manually.Type: ApplicationFiled: July 18, 2014Publication date: November 6, 2014Inventors: Mark Carlson, Patrick Stan, Patrick L. Faith, Benjamin Rewis

Publication number: 20110047076Abstract: Systems and method for generating reputation information for an alias are provided. The alias is associated with an entity. Payment transaction information related to a first alias associated with a first entity is received. The payment transaction information includes payment transactions performed by the first entity. In addition, non-payment transaction information related to the first alias is also received. The non-payment transactions include transaction between the first alias and one or more objects. The payment transaction information and the non-payment transaction information is analyzed to associate the one or more objects with the first alias. Thereafter, reputation information for the first alias is generated based at least in part on the payment transaction information and the non-payment transaction information.Type: ApplicationFiled: July 29, 2010Publication date: February 24, 2011Inventors: Mark Carlson, Patrick Stan, Patrick Faith, Benjamin Rewis
